96SEO 2026-06-14 13:14 1
哈喽各位小伙伴们!Zui近是不是总有人问你们“RNZuo跨端直播到底要不要全换成一套代码啊”?哈哈我跟你说呀,这事咱们可不Neng一刀切——当初我们团队踩过无数坑才明白:有些原生边界啊,打死dou不Neng丢!不然轻则卡顿闪退,重则用户跑光光…今天就跟你们唠唠,我们到底留了哪些native底线没动.
先别急着 “全 RN 化”——直播核心是 “Neng播Neng连”,这活儿只Neng native 扛咱就是说啊,直播App 的命门是什么?是音视频链路啊喂!播放器会不会卡帧?推流延迟有没有控制在50ms内?弱网环境下会不会自动切码率?这些玩意儿要是交给 RN 去搞…呵呵,我敢打赌你下周就要蹲在服务器机房哭.

记得去年我们试水纯 RN 直播间的时候,信心满满觉得 “JS引擎这么快,渲染还Neng比 native 差?”结果一测吓一跳:iOS设备上播放1080P高清流,RN页面直接掉帧到30fps以下;Android低端机geng惨——推流时偶发卡顿不说,还经常触发ANR.后来找 native 同学会诊才知道:原来人家 native 的播放器 SDK 里藏了多少黑科技?硬件加速解码、动态码率调整、本地缓存预加载…这些dou是 RN 的JS线程根本玩不转的数据密集型操作.
你懂吗?就像让一个程序员去扛煤气罐一样——不是不行,但专业事儿还得专业人干!所以现在我们果断把视频播放/推流内核「钉死」在 native : iOS用AVFoundation+FFmpeg优化版,Androidd用MediaCodec+ExoPlayer定制版,RN?只负责调用 native 的播放器接口就行——连参数配置dou是 native 封装好的数据结构,RNZui多传个URL和清晰度等级.
系统权限和硬件调用?别让 RN “瞎掰扯”,native 才懂各端脾气再说个扎心事实:每个手机系统dou是个 “傲娇小公主”——iOS查权限比审犯人还严,Androidd从10开始各种分区存储限制,HarmonyOS又有自己一套分布式权限模型.要是让 RN 去处理这些?分分钟给你整出 “权限申请失败但不报异常” 的玄学bug.
就好比上次项目里小吴同学想实现 “直播时自动录制片段” 的功Neng:他兴高采烈用 RN 的react-native-camera库写了段代码,Androidd12以上机型全崩——原因是没动态申请RECORDAUDIO和WRITEEXTERNAL_STORAGE两个权限;iOS那边geng绝:用户同意授权后,camera预览画面居然是镜像反转的!Zui后还是native组老大出马:给Androidd封装了个带兼容逻辑の权限管理器,iOS那边加了句setMirroringEnabled才搞定.
害...所以现在我们明确规定:所有系统硬件调用 和敏感权限申请,必须由 native 层统一封装成接口.RN要调用?行啊——按我定好の参数格式来,String类型传路径,int类型传权限码;要是敢乱改参数?出了事算你的!
“实时性”这种要命の东西,RN 的异步回调玩不起直播Zui讲究什么?秒级响应!主播刚送完礼物,RN页面隔两秒才弹出动画;用户发弹幕,native长连收到消息半天才刷新UI...这种延迟感够用户卸载三次 App 了.
说实话啊,R Nの事件循环机制决定了它不太擅长处理 “高频低延迟”の任务:JS线程和UI线程の通信靠Bridge桥接器,每次调用dou要序列化/反序列化数据— —听起来好像hen快?但碰到每秒几十次の弹幕消息同步呢?Bridge队列hen容易堵成停车场!
我们之前就吃过亏:把 “礼物连击动画” 的逻辑扔给了 RN .结果高峰期同时有百人送礼,R N页面居然卡成PPT— —不是代码写错了!是Bridge排队排不过来!后来还是把实时消息分发放回native长连链路:native收到消息直接扔给UI线程渲染,R N只负责显示Zui终结果.现在好了,native管传输速度,R N管显示效果— —配合得天衣无缝.
“为什么百度不收录我的技术文章?”哦?该不会是你犯了这几个错聊到这儿突然想到个题外话— —上周有个粉丝问我:“哥我写のRN踩坑文咋百度一直不收?”害...这事吧其实挺常见の— —搜索引擎又不是傻狍子,它kanの是 “内容有没有价值”.
你想啊:要是你写の东西全是 “react-native init项目步骤”这种随处可见の模板文?百度爬过去一kan “这篇跟别的没区别”,肯定懒得收;再要么就是文章里没干货— —光列几个报错代码不写解决方法,who会kan?还有哦!别忘了给文章加几个关键词— —比如“RN直播卡顿解决方法”“native桥接层报错排查”— —搜索引擎搜这类问题时才Neng精准找到你.
哦对还有!geng新频率hen重要— —每周geng两篇比一个月geng一篇管用多啦~毕竟谁会收藏一篇半年不gengの旧文呢?
“那 RN到底Neng干啥?”当然是干 native 嫌麻烦の “变来变去”业务说了这么多.nativeの活计咱们留好了.RN总不Neng吃干饭吧?当然不是!它Zui擅长の「多端业务快速迭代」「UI一致性」「配置化运营」— —这些活儿.native可是嫌麻烦不欲接手의!
比如说现在直播间里の「节日主题皮肤」「新人福利弹窗」「互动玩法按钮」— —这些需求今天改文案明天换配色后天加动画.native改一次就要发三个版本,黄花菜dou凉啦!但R N不一样:前端同学改改JSX文件配配JSON配置,native只要嵌好R N容器— —热geng新一发全网立刻生效!
再比如说「主播资料卡」模块:native实现要分别写iOSのTableViewCell和AndroidのRecyclerView适配器.R N呢?一套代码走天下— —就连圆角头像丶关注按钮丶历史直播列表dou是同一个组件.render函数一改全端同步geng新.这不香吗?!
Zui后:跨端不是 “消灭差异”,而是 “守住底线找平衡”唠到这儿估计你们也明白了:我们ZuoR N跨端直播并没有追求 “所有代码一份通吃”.反而认认真真爱惜着native那些年磨出来の「核心边界」— —音视频链路丶系统硬件丶实时状态同步...这些dou是native安身立命之本,R N休想抢班夺权.
而R N呢?就老老实实在上层干好自己份内事:快速迭代业务UI丶承接多端端配置化需求丶替native挡下那些 “今天变明天改’’旳运营需求.
这样一来既保住了之live体验不拉胯,又提升了之研发效率.简直完美嘛~
哦对啦差点忘了说!:之前有人问我们HarmonyOS试点咋样啦?.嘿嘿告诉你们个好消息:HarmonyOS上R N容器Yi经稳定运行三个月咯!.从Zui初だ基础页面渲染到现在承接主播列表丶礼物面板等核心业务模块— -帧率稳定在60fps+,崩溃率不到万分之一!.kan来咱们这套 "守住native底线.RN补位迭代"哒思路呀..是真滴行!
作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back